**Action item: PM-207 — nightly search reindex overrun**

During the incident on the Shearmont cluster, the nightly reindex ran past the maintenance window and overlapped with morning traffic, causing stale results and elevated query latency. Support should know: partial indexes are expected during the window, and customers may briefly see missing recent items — this is safe to communicate. Engineering has split the reindex into bounded phases with a hard cutoff. The schedule and safety limits are governed by the constants below.

tuning constants:
QUOTAS = {
    "druwyn": 5,
    "holix": 5,
    "zorath": 5,
    "holwyn": 10,
}

[ ] Key ceremony step 7 — TimeLoom signing key rotation. Before the Bellweather district deploy of the TimeLoom school timetable solver, two support staff must witness the sealing of the new signing key. Verify the ceremony laptop is offline, record the witnesses' names in the ledger, and confirm the old key is marked retired. Once both witnesses sign, unseal the escrow envelope to complete the handover. The escrow envelope's recovery passphrase appears below.

strongbox words: norwyn-wenael-aldvan-aldiel-wendor-holael

Handing off the Quillbus broker upgrade (4.x to 5.1) to Dario. Cluster is half-migrated; mixed-version mode is supported but TLS cert rotation must finish before cutover. No auth model changes, though the admin API gained two new endpoints worth reviewing. Open questions and the migration checklist are tracked on the internal page below.

dashboard of taduf-bawef = https://jira.lumicsys.internal/projects/display/browse/b1cbf89d